Community / Political Organizer

All community and social service specialists not listed separately.

At a Glance

Community / Political Organizer earns an average of $61,681/yr. Typical education: Associate degree. Experience: 2–2.5 years. Top skills: Microsoft PowerPoint, Community Outreach, Communication.
